Categorical exclusions are categories of actions that a federal agency has determined, in its NEPA procedures, normally do not have a significant effect on the human environment and for which, therefore, neither an environmental assessment nor an environmental impact statement normally is required.

Categorical Exclusions (CXs, or CEs): Categorical exclusions are actions which the BLM has identified do not significantly affect the quality of the human environment. These include installing protective grates on abandoned mines or permitting temporary livestock feeding during periods of drought.
Other notable wildlife species found in the area include the badger, desert tortoise and kit fox. Bird species that occur at Kofa include the white-winged dove, American kestrel, northern flicker, Say's phoebe, cactus wren, phainopepla, and orange-crowned warbler.

The National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A) defines categorical exclusions (CEs) as a category of actions that a Federal agency has determined normally does not significantly affect the quality of the human environment (42 USC 4336e (1); 40 CFR 1508.1(d)).

The Kofa National Wildlife Refuge Categorical Exclusion Document is a formal document used to classify certain activities or projects within the refuge that do not require a detailed environmental impact statement or environmental assessment due to their minimal impact on the environment.
Individuals or organizations proposing projects or activities within the Kofa National Wildlife Refuge that may fall under the criteria for categorical exclusions are required to file this document.
To fill out the Kofa National Wildlife Refuge Categorical Exclusion Document, one must provide specific information about the proposed project, including description, location, potential impacts, and mitigation measures, following the guidelines set by the refuge management.
The purpose of the Kofa National Wildlife Refuge Categorical Exclusion Document is to streamline the review process for low-impact projects, ensuring that they comply with environmental regulations while conserving time and resources.
The information that must be reported includes project title, description, location, anticipated environmental effects, any necessary permits, and measures taken to avoid or minimize negative impacts on the environment.
